我正在尝试编写一个可以为我做散点图的函数

我正在使用的数据结构如下:

我设法在不编写函数的情况下进行绘制,并且代码可以正常工作:

with(nfl,plot(nfl$Dash40,nfl$BenchPress,
              pch=c(1,3,4,2,0,8,5),
              col=c("black","red","blue","darkgreen","purple","orange","gray"),
              xlab = "Bench Press weight", 
              ylab="40-year dash time in seconds"),
              panel.first = grid())
legend("bottomright", legend=levels(nfl$Position), 
       pch=c(1,3,4,2,0,8,5),
       cex=0.5,
       col=c("black","red","blue","darkgreen","purple","orange","gray"))
a<-paste(nfl$Player,nfl$BenchPress)
text(nfl$Dash40,nfl$BenchPress,label=as.character(a),cex=0.5)

所以基本上我想看看不同数值变量之间的关系,并且我认为如果上面的代码可以正常工作,那么以下函数也应该可以正常工作,

myplot<-function(xvar,yvar,xlab,ylab){
  b<-paste("xlab","vs","ylab")
  xvar<-nfl$"xvar"
  yvar<-nfl$"yvar"
  with(nfl,plot(yvar,xvar),
                pch=c(1,3,4,2,0,8,5),
                col=c("black","red","blue","darkgreen","purple","orange","gray"),
                xlab="xlab",ylab="ylab",
                main="b")
}

myplot(Dash40,BenchPress,dash,bench)

我使用Dash40和BenchPress来测试该功能,但事实证明该功能不起作用:

Error in plot.window(...) : need finite 'xlim' values
In addition: Warning messages:
1: In min(x) : no non-missing arguments to min; returning Inf
2: In max(x) : no non-missing arguments to max; returning -Inf
3: In min(x) : no non-missing arguments to min; returning Inf
4: In max(x) :

基本上,我正在尝试使用两种不同的代码来完成相同的工作,为什么第二种代码不起作用?有人可以给我一些解决问题的障碍吗?

您的职能让我很困惑。为什么它的参数xvar,yvar会被不用而覆盖?

nfl$"xvar"nfl$"yvar"是什么意思?

自从您随后使用with(nfl,...以来,为什么要这样做呢?

如果nfl没有名为xvaryvar的列,则它们将导致错误或被解释为NULL;如果您绘制NULL,则需要指定图表的界限,因为无法从数据中找到。

该函数失败,因为您正在绘制NULL

您还需要将数据从nfl传递给函数,因为存在危险Dash40BenchPress找不到,因为它们仅存在于nfl中。为此,请使用$符号。您应该将BenchPress传递给函数,而不是nfl$BenchPress

以下内容应该起作用。

myplot<-function(xvar,yvar,xlab,ylab){
  b<-paste(xlab,"vs",ylab)
  plot(yvar,xvar,
                pch=c(1,3,4,2,0,8,5),
                col=c("black","red","blue","darkgreen","purple","orange","gray"),
                xlab=xlab,ylab=ylab,
                main=b)
}

myplot(nfl$Dash40,nfl$BenchPress,"dash","bench")
